Recomendado: Como gerar imagens de imagens digitais em páginas da web Salve o seguinte código como myimg.asp e insira imgsrc = myimg.asp? Tel = 010-0000000 na posição em que o número a ser exibido (como número qq, etc.). % CallCom_CreatValidCode (Request.QueryString (Tel)) PublicsubCom_CreatValidCode (PTEL) '---------- 禁止缓存 Response.expires = 0 Resposta.
No ASP, fornecemos funções especiais de adição e subtração de data.1. Adicione datas
Função DATADD
Retorna a data em que o intervalo de tempo especificado foi adicionado.
DataAdd (intervalo, número, data)
A sintaxe da função DATADD tem os seguintes parâmetros
(1) opções obrigatórias para intervalos. Uma expressão de string que indica o intervalo de tempo a ser adicionado. Para valores, consulte a seção Configurações.
(2) Número necessário. Expressão numérica, indicando o número de intervalos de tempo a serem adicionados. Expressões numéricas podem ser positivas (obtenha datas futuras) ou negativas (supere as datas).
(3) uma opção de data necessária. Variante ou texto que representa a data para adicionar intervalo.
ilustrar
A função DATADD pode ser usada para adicionar ou subtrair o intervalo de tempo especificado a partir da data. Por exemplo, o DATADD pode ser usado para calcular a data de 30 dias a partir do mesmo dia ou para calcular o tempo 45 minutos a partir dos dias atuais. Para adicionar um intervalo de tempo nos dias até o momento, você pode usar o número de dias (y), dias (d) de um ano ou o número de dias (w) de uma semana.
A função DATADD não retorna uma data inválida. O exemplo a seguir adiciona um mês a 31 de janeiro de 2019:
NewDate = DATADD (M, 1,31-Jan-95)
Neste exemplo, o DataEDD retorna em 28 de fevereiro de 95, em vez de 31 de fevereiro de 95. Se a data for 31 de janeiro de 2019, retorna em 29 de fevereiro de 2019, porque 1996 é um ano bissexto.
Se a data calculada for antes de 100 dC, um erro será gerado.
Se o número não for um valor longo, arredondado para o número inteiro mais próximo antes do cálculo.
2. Data de subtração
Função datediff
Retorna o intervalo de tempo entre duas datas.
Datediff (intervalo, date1, date2 [, FirstdayOfWeek [, FirstWeekofyear]])
A sintaxe da função datediff tem os seguintes parâmetros:
(1) opções obrigatórias para intervalos. Uma expressão de string que representa o intervalo de tempo usado para calcular Date1 e Date2. Para valores, consulte a seção Configurações.
(2) As opções necessárias para Date1 e Date2. Expressão de data. Duas datas usadas para cálculo.
(3) O primeiro dia da semana é opcional. Especifica a constante para o primeiro dia da semana. Se não for especificado, o padrão é domingo. Para valores, consulte a seção Configurações.
(4) O primeiro ano é opcional. Especifique a constante para a primeira semana do ano. Se não for especificado, o padrão é a semana em 1º de janeiro. Para valores, consulte a seção Configurações.
ilustrar
A função datediff é usada para determinar o número de intervalos de tempo especificados que existem entre duas datas. Por exemplo, você pode usar o Datediff para calcular o número de dias em que as duas datas diferem ou o número de semanas entre o mesmo dia e o último dia do ano.
Para calcular o número de dias entre Date1 e Date2, você pode usar o número de dias (y) ou dias (d) de um ano. Quando o intervalo é o número de dias da semana (W), o datediff retorna o número de dias da semana entre as duas datas. Se Date1 for segunda -feira, o DATEDIFF calcula o número de segundas -feiras antes do Date2. Este resultado contém date2 e não date1. Se o intervalo for semana (WW), a função datediff retorna o número de semanas entre duas datas na tabela de calendário. A função calcula o número de domingos entre Date1 e Date2. Se o Date2 for domingo, o datediff calculará o Date2, mas mesmo que o Date1 seja domingo, o Date1 não será calculado.
Se a data1 for posterior a data2, a função datediff retorna um número negativo.
O parâmetro FirstdayofWeek terá um impacto no cálculo usando símbolos de intervalo W e WW.
Se Date1 ou Date2 for um texto de data, o ano especificado se tornará uma parte fixa da data. Mas se o Date1 ou Date2 estiver incluído nas Quotes () e o ano for omitido, o ano atual será inserido toda vez que a expressão Date1 ou Date2 é calculada no código. Isso permite que você escreva o código do programa por diferentes anos.
Quando o intervalo é ano (AAA), compare 31 de dezembro e 1º de janeiro do ano seguinte. Embora na verdade seja apenas um dia de intervalo, o datediff retorna 1 para indicar uma diferença de um ano.
Compartilhar: como impedir o roubo de ligação ilegal deste site Atualmente, existem muitos links ilegais para roubo de páginas e arquivos da Web em outros sites. O método a seguir é para evitar links usando o código ASP. A idéia principal é usar a solicitação.Servervariables para coletar http_referrer e, em seguida, determinar se o link vem de fora com base no valor dessa variável para evitar links ilegais. Primeiro, precisamos citar a imagem da seguinte forma: imgsrc =